Sukta 1.141
प्र यत्पितुः परमान्नीयते पर्या पृक्षुधो वीरुधो दंसु रोहति । उभा यदस्य जनुषं यदिन्वत आदिद्यविष्ठो अभवद्घृणा शुचिः ॥
prá yat pitúḥ paramā́n nīyáte páry ā́ pṛkṣúdhó vīrúdhó dáṃsu rohati | ubhā́ yád asya jánuṣaṃ yád ínvata ād íd yáviṣṭho abhavad ghṛṇā́ śúciḥ ||
彼が至高の父より導き出されるとき、その周りに滋養の生長—草木—が、その巧みなる力によって萌え立つ。彼の二つの誕生が動き出すとき、まことに最も若き者は清らかな輝きとなり、熱情の光を燃え立たせる。
